For comedy fans, the news that Adam McKay and Will Ferrell are folding their production company Gary Sanchez Productions hit like some kind of Hollywood divorce – the beloved partnership behind Step Brothers, The Other Guys, and Eastbound & Down, among others, sadly coming to an end. But the truth of it is, there was no falling out, no fundamental disagreement – just an amicable parting of the ways. McKay speaks about the company’s end for the first time in the new issue of Empire. “We both felt it had got pretty big and it was time to start up anew,” he explains in the summer issue. “It’s the best time.”

After meeting on SNL, Ferrell and McKay collaborated on the likes of Anchorman and Talladega Nights, going on to establish Gary Sanchez Productions in 2006 – though in recent years, McKay has moved into different filmmaking territory with the likes of The Big Short and Vice, neither of which starred Ferrell. But despite the wrapping up of Gary Sanchez, McKay says this isn’t the end of him and Ferrell working together. “We have an idea we’re kicking around right now which we’d love to do,” he teased. “If he and I didn’t work together, that would be heartbreaking. We’re going to do everything we can to make sure that’s not the case.”
